Souffrance, whose real name is Sofiane, has emerged as a prominent figure in the French rap scene with his new album Hiver Automne, released in 2025. Born in Guinea, Souffrance's music career began to take shape in the 2010s in Montreuil, France, where he formed a solid team, L'uZine, and developed a style inspired by the golden era of 1990s rap. His music has evolved significantly since his mixtape Noctambus in 2020 and his first album Tranches de vie in 2021.
In an interview with RFI Musique, Souffrance shared the story behind his stage name, which he adopted during Nicolas Sarkozy's presidential election in France. The term "Souffrance" resonated with him, as it reflected the struggles of those living in disadvantaged communities. Souffrance's music style is often described as pessimistic, but he prefers to call it realistic and cold, with a hint of hope. He aims to convey meaningful messages through his lyrics, which he believes are essential to rap music.
Souffrance's album Hiver Automne features collaborations with renowned artists, including Canadian musician Chilly Gonzales and French rapper Soprano. The album's production was a unique experience, with Chilly Gonzales providing a USB drive with his compositions, which were then used as samples by Souffrance's producer, Tony Toxik. The collaboration resulted in a distinctive sound that blends Souffrance's trap and electro style with Gonzales's musicality.
One of the standout tracks on the album is "Compte double," featuring Soprano. Souffrance invited Soprano to collaborate on the track, and the two artists worked together seamlessly. Soprano's verse is notable for its complex flow and socially conscious lyrics. The track also features a unique blend of scratch and accordion, which adds to its distinctive sound.
Souffrance's music often explores themes of social inequality and personal struggle. He believes that rap music has become more commercialized, but he remains committed to creating meaningful lyrics. Souffrance's use of Auto-tune is subtle, and he views it as a tool to enhance his music, rather than relying on it as a gimmick.
The rap scene in France is currently thriving, with many artists achieving significant success. Souffrance believes that rap's popularity is due to its accessibility and the fact that it can be created with minimal equipment. He predicts that rap will continue to evolve and endure, as it provides a platform for people to express themselves and share their experiences.
